Streamlining Recruitment Plans for Growing AI Companies
Recruitment is one of the most critical aspects of growing any company, and this is especially true for AI companies where competition is forever increasing, and experienced talent is in high demand. Streamlining your recruitment plans can help you attract top talent more efficiently and effectively, ensuring your company's growth is both robust and sustainable.
Why is finding talent for AI companies challenging?
The rapid growth and evolution of the AI industry have created a high demand for skilled professionals. However, finding the right talent for AI companies can be particularly challenging due to several factors. Here are some key reasons why:
High Demand and Competition
Industry Boom: The AI industry is booming, with applications spanning various sectors, including healthcare, finance, automotive, and more. This widespread adoption of AI technologies has significantly increased the demand for skilled professionals.
Competitive Market: Top technology companies and startups fiercely compete for the same AI talent pool. This competition drives up salaries and makes it harder for smaller companies to attract and retain skilled workers.
Specialised Skill Sets Required
Complex Skill Requirements: Technical AI roles often require deep theoretical knowledge and practical skills. Professionals need to be proficient in programming languages like Python and R, understand machine learning algorithms, and be familiar with frameworks like TensorFlow and PyTorch. Even sales and marketing teams need a deeper understanding of your product and AI to represent your company effectively.
Continuous Learning: The AI field is continuously evolving, with new research, tools, and techniques emerging regularly. Professionals need to stay updated with the latest advancements, which requires a commitment to ongoing learning and development.
Limited Educational Programs
Slow Academic Adaptation: While universities and educational institutions are gradually expanding their AI-related programs, there is still a gap between industry needs and the output of qualified graduates. Traditional computer science programs may not cover the latest AI technologies in depth.
Quality of Training: Not all educational programs offer the same quality and practical training. Graduates from top-tier universities or specialised AI programs are highly sought after, leaving a gap in the availability of well-trained professionals.
Experience and Expertise
Experience Gap: Many AI projects require theoretical knowledge and practical experience in deploying AI models in real-world scenarios. Experienced AI professionals who have successfully led projects are in short supply.
Research and Development: Expertise in AI often involves a strong background in research and development. Professionals with a Ph.D. or substantial research experience are particularly valuable, and their availability is limited.
Geographical Constraints
Global Talent Distribution: AI talent is distributed unevenly across the globe. Certain regions, such as Silicon Valley, have a higher concentration of AI professionals. Companies outside these hubs may struggle to attract top talent.
Relocation Challenges: Convincing skilled professionals to relocate can be challenging due to personal, cultural, or logistical reasons. Remote work options can help mitigate this, but not all roles are suited to remote arrangements.
Diverse Roles and Interdisciplinary Skills
Variety of Roles: AI companies require a variety of roles, from data scientists and machine learning engineers to UX designers, product managers, and sales professionals. Each role has its own specific requirements, making the recruitment process more complex.
Interdisciplinary Nature: Effective AI projects often require collaboration between technical and non-technical teams. Professionals need to have multidisciplinary skills and the ability to work across different domains, which adds another layer of complexity to the recruitment process.
Ethical and Societal Impact
Ethical Considerations: AI development and deployment have significant ethical and societal implications. Professionals with expertise in AI ethics, data privacy, and regulatory compliance are essential but rare.
Public Perception: The societal impact of AI technologies can influence the attractiveness of roles within AI companies. Potential employees may be concerned about working on projects with controversial or negative social implications.
How can you overcome these challenges?
1. Define Clear Job Roles and Responsibilities
One of the most fundamental steps in streamlining recruitment is to define clear and precise job roles and responsibilities. Given the diversity of roles in AI companies, it's crucial to:
Create Detailed Job Descriptions: Clearly outline the skills, qualifications, and experience required for each role, whether it's in software development, data science, marketing, sales, HR, or customer support.
Identify Core Competencies: Determine the core competencies needed for each position. Technical roles might include programming languages and tools. For non-technical roles, focus on relevant industry experience and skills.
2. Develop a Strategic Recruitment Plan
A strategic recruitment plan aligns your hiring needs with your business goals. Consider the following steps:
Analyse Future Needs: Predict future hiring needs and the talent required across all departments. This will help you stay ahead and avoid rushing any hiring process.
Set Timelines: Establish timelines for each hiring phase, from job posting to onboarding. This ensures that the recruitment process is efficient and timely.
Budget Allocation: Allocate budgets for recruitment activities, including job ads, external recruitment assistance, and potential relocation costs for candidates.
3. Leverage Technology and Recruitment Software
Technology can significantly streamline your recruitment process. Utilise advanced recruitment software and tools to manage and automate various aspects of hiring:
Applicant Tracking Systems (ATS): An ATS can help you manage job applications, track candidates through the recruitment pipeline, and maintain a database of potential hires.
AI-Powered Recruitment Tools: These tools can assist in screening resumes, scheduling interviews, and assessing candidate skills through automated tests.
Job Portals and Professional Networks: Post job openings on LinkedIn, Indeed, and specialised job boards. Engage with professional networks and communities to find potential candidates.
While AI enhances efficiency and decision-making, it can also impact the candidate experience in ways that might not align with your company's values and goals. Before implementing AI, consider whether it could be impacting your company's recruitment experience.
4. Implement a Rigorous Screening Process
A rigorous screening process ensures that only the most qualified candidates move forward. This involves:
· Initial Resume Screening: Use AI tools to filter resumes based on predefined criteria such as skills, experience, and educational background.
· Technical and Non-Technical Assessments: Conduct appropriate tests to evaluate candidates' proficiency, whether coding tests for developers or situational judgment tests for customer service roles.
· Behavioural Interviews: Assess cultural fit and soft skills through behavioural interviews. Use structured interview techniques to ensure consistency and fairness.
5. Engage with AI Communities and Networks
Engaging with AI communities and professional networks can be a great way to find and attract top talent:
Attend Conferences and Meetups: Participate in industry conferences, workshops, and meetups. This helps you network and showcase your company as a leader in the AI space.
Online Forums and Groups: Engage with online forums such as Reddit, professional groups on LinkedIn, and other industry-specific communities.
University Collaborations: Collaborate with universities and research institutions. Offer internships, sponsor AI-related events, and participate in university career fairs.
6. Partner with Specialist Search Firms
Specialist search firms that understand the AI industry can effectively and efficiently find people that match your specifications.
Industry Expertise: These firms have in-depth knowledge of the AI sector and can help you find candidates with the specific skills and experience you need.
Access to a Broader Talent Pool: They have access to a network of professionals who might not be actively looking for a job but are open to opportunities.
Efficient Hiring: They can streamline the recruitment process by pre-screening candidates, thus saving your HR team time and resources.
Read four ways to identify the right recruiter for your business.
7. Offer Competitive Compensation and Benefits
Top talent is highly sought after, so offering competitive compensation and benefits is essential:
Salary Benchmarking: Conduct market research to understand the salary trends for various roles. Ensure your compensation packages are competitive.
Benefits and Perks: Provide attractive benefits such as flexible working hours, remote work options, health insurance, and opportunities for continuous learning and development.
Equity and Bonuses: Consider offering stock options or performance-based bonuses to attract and retain top talent.
8. Foster an Inclusive and Collaborative Culture
Creating a positive work environment is crucial for attracting and retaining talent:
Diversity and Inclusion: Promote diversity and inclusion in your hiring practices. Diverse teams bring varied perspectives and drive innovation.
Collaborative Environment: Foster a collaborative culture where employees can collaborate on cutting-edge projects. Encourage knowledge sharing and continuous learning.
Employee Development: Invest in your employees' professional development. Provide opportunities for training, attending conferences, and earning certifications.
9. Optimise the Onboarding Process
A streamlined onboarding process ensures new hires are productive and integrated into the team quickly:
Pre-Onboarding Preparation: Prepare all necessary documentation, equipment, and access to tools before the new hire's first day.
Structured Onboarding Program: Develop a structured onboarding program that includes company orientation, team introductions, and initial training sessions.
Mentorship and Support: Assign mentors to new hires to help them navigate their new roles and integrate into the company culture.
10. Continuous Improvement and Feedback
Lastly, continuously improve your recruitment process by seeking feedback and analysing metrics:
Candidate Feedback: Collect feedback from candidates about their recruitment experience. Use this feedback to identify areas for improvement.
Recruitment Metrics: Track key recruitment metrics such as time-to-hire, cost-per-hire, and quality of hire. Analyse these metrics to identify bottlenecks and improve efficiency.
Iterative Improvement: Regularly review and refine your recruitment strategies based on feedback and performance data. Stay adaptable to changing industry trends and candidate expectations.
Streamlining your recruitment plans is essential for the growth and success of your AI company. By defining clear job roles, developing a strategic plan, leveraging technology, implementing a rigorous screening process, engaging with AI communities, partnering with specialist search firms, offering competitive compensation, fostering a positive culture, optimising onboarding, and continuously improving your processes, you can attract and retain the top talent needed to drive your company's innovation and growth. Remember, the recruitment process is not just about filling positions; it's about building a strong, capable, and motivated team that can propel your company towards success in the dynamic field of artificial intelligence.
Find out more about Oakstoneās AI recruitment experience.